SQLServer2008入门指南:从基础知识到数据库解决方案

需积分: 9 0 下载量 40 浏览量 更新于2024-07-25 收藏 1.36MB PDF 举报
"SQLServer2008基础教程" 在深入探讨SQL Server 2008的基础知识之前,首先需要理解数据库的基本概念。SQL Server 2008是一款由微软公司开发的关系型数据库管理系统(RDBMS),它广泛应用于数据存储、管理和分析。本教程旨在引导初学者和有一定经验的开发者或数据库管理员熟悉SQL Server 2008的各个方面。 安装与创建数据库是入门的第一步。SQL Server 2008提供了多种版本,如Express、Developer、Standard、Enterprise等,适用于不同规模和需求的用户。安装过程中,你需要选择合适的版本,并配置好硬件和软件环境。安装完成后,可以通过SQL Server Management Studio (SSMS) 这个图形化界面工具来管理和操作数据库。SSMS允许用户创建、修改和管理数据库对象,如表、视图、存储过程等。 数据库安全是不可忽视的部分。在SQL Server 2008中,你可以设置权限和角色,限制对数据的访问,确保只有授权的用户才能进行特定的操作。这包括创建用户、分配角色、设置登录和权限,以及使用SQL Server的身份验证和Windows身份验证模式。 查询是数据库系统的核心功能。SQL(Structured Query Language)是用于与关系数据库交互的语言,而Transact-SQL (T-SQL) 是SQL Server的扩展,增加了更多用于处理和管理数据库的特性和命令。通过学习T-SQL,你可以插入、更新、删除数据,执行复杂的查询,以及创建存储过程和触发器。 本书的示例将涵盖从基本的SELECT语句到复杂的联接、子查询和聚合函数的使用。这些实践性的例子将帮助你理解SQL Server 2008如何处理数据,并逐步提升你的技能。此外,还会介绍事务处理,确保数据的一致性和完整性。 备份与恢复是数据库管理的关键环节。SQL Server 2008提供了多种备份类型,如完整备份、差异备份和日志备份,以应对不同的恢复策略。你将学习如何制定备份计划,执行备份操作,并在必要时进行数据恢复。 最后,报告生成是数据呈现和分析的重要手段。通过SQL Server Reporting Services,你可以创建各种类型的报表,包括表格、图表和仪表板,以满足业务需求。报表设计不仅涉及数据的提取,还包括样式和布局的设定,使其易于理解和解读。 SQL Server 2008基础教程是一本全面的指南,无论你是初学者还是有经验的开发者,都可以从中受益。通过这本书,你将逐步掌握数据库设计、管理、查询和安全的最佳实践,为构建稳定可靠的数据库解决方案打下坚实的基础。